As I mentioned in a post that feels like it was ages ago – since I’ve re-embraced my love of all things playscale (1:6, or in my case with custom furniture more likely 1:5ish), I see things in the world around me quite differently than the non-doll obsessed.

Today’s Doll Haul might just look like a couple of small, stylized tea cups sold as “refills” for a tea set and a series of hair scrunchies…

But in Eve’s world, they become something very different.

Even without being sliced into, the scrunchies become very affordable and stylish scarves. I especially like the way the checkered (or is that houndstooth?) one looks on her.

With a little greenery, the tea cups become large floor pots, for potted plants. Granted, they’ll need something to stick into (like leftover packing material) to hold them in place, but that’s easily done.

Keep your eyes open for goodies, they’re all around you (and they’re generally more affordable than official items sold specifically as Barbie goods).
